Spotify’s chief executive has defended the company’s pivot into AI-generated music, arguing that a new remix feature offers a better alternative to piracy and unregulated AI content. The tool, developed in partnership with Universal Music Group, allows premium subscribers to create AI-powered remixes and song covers using tracks from participating artists.

Spotify’s CEO recently addressed the company’s expanding role in artificial intelligence, championing a new feature that lets premium users generate AI-driven remixes and song covers from licensed music. The executive described the move as a controlled, artist-friendly response to the rise of unregulated AI “slop” and digital piracy. Last week, the streaming platform unveiled the remix tool, which is built on an agreement with Universal Music Group (UMG). Under the arrangement, participating artists can choose whether their music is available for AI-generated derivative works. The CEO emphasized that the feature provides a legitimate creative outlet for users while safeguarding artist royalties and copyrights—an alternative to the “wild west” of unauthorized AI music generation and pirated content. The announcement builds on Spotify’s existing experiments with AI, such as personalized playlists and voice-controlled recommendations. The company has not disclosed the precise technology stack or licensing fees involved, but it described the tool as a “controlled environment” that respects artist consent. The partnership with UMG, one of the largest music rights holders globally, suggests that major labels may be willing to explore sanctioned AI uses when artist protections are included. The collaboration with Universal Music Group signals a potential shift in how streaming platforms and record labels navigate the AI landscape. By embedding artist opt-in and royalty structures into the remix feature, Spotify may reduce the legal and reputational risks that have plagued other AI music applications. The move could set a precedent for future licensing agreements in an industry where AI-generated content has historically been a point of contention. From a competitive standpoint, the feature could strengthen Spotify’s premium tier by offering a unique, interactive experience that competing services may not yet provide. This differentiation might help the company retain subscribers and attract new users who value creative customization. However, the feature’s success will likely depend on widespread artist participation and user adoption. If a significant number of high-profile artists decline to opt in, the library of remixable tracks may remain limited, potentially dampening consumer interest. The announcement also comes amid broader regulatory scrutiny of AI in entertainment. Lawmakers in several regions are considering rules around consent, compensation, and transparency for AI-generated works. Spotify’s approach—anchored in a formal agreement with a major label—could be viewed as a proactive model that aligns with emerging compliance expectations. For investors, Spotify’s AI music strategy may influence its subscription growth and margin trajectory in the medium term. The remix feature adds a compelling reason for users to maintain or upgrade to a premium account, potentially boosting average revenue per user (ARPU). However, the costs associated with licensing and developing the AI tool could affect near-term profitability. The company has not provided specific financial guidance for the feature. The broader implications extend to the music industry’s evolving relationship with AI. If Spotify’s controlled-consent model gains traction, it could encourage other streaming platforms to pursue similar arrangements with labels. This might reduce litigation risk and create new revenue streams for artists through AI-driven derivative works. Conversely, any misstep—such as unauthorized use or insufficient artist payouts—could invite regulatory backlash or damage the company’s reputation with creators. It is also worth noting that the competitive landscape for AI music remains fluid. Rivals like Apple Music and Amazon Music are investing in AI features, though none have yet announced a comparable remix tool. Spotify’s early-mover advantage could be significant, but it may also face increasing pressure to expand the feature to more artists and genres. The company has not disclosed a timeline for broader rollout beyond the initial launch. As with any emerging technology, the long-term impact of AI on streaming economics is uncertain. Adoption rates, artist participation, and regulatory clarity will all play roles in determining whether this initiative drives sustainable value. Investors should monitor user engagement metrics and any updates to royalty structures in the coming quarters.
